R41.1 ANTEROGRADE AMNESIA


Code Information

Diagnosis Code: R41.1

Short Description: Anterograde amnesia

Long Description: Anterograde amnesia

The code R41.1 is VALID for claim submission

Code Classification:

  • Symptoms, signs and abnormal clinical and laboratory findings, not elsewhere classified (R00–R99)
    • Symptoms and signs involving cognition, perception, emotional state and behavior (R40-R46)
      • Oth symptoms and signs w cognitive functions and awareness (R41)
        • R41.1 Anterograde amnesia

Code Version: 2022 ICD-10-CM
